Introduction
A successful workforce strategy is rooted in the mission, vision, and major goals of the organization, and
it has impact on all parts of the employee lifecycle. In this final assignment, you will assess your
organization broadly on its workforce strategy and people management processes. You will use a People
Management Scorecard tool to pull together your evaluation of the various components of people
management across the organization.
The areas you will assess are:
1. Alignment with Mission, Vision, and Goals
2. Hiring Process
3. Team Motivation and Virtual Teams
4. Differentiation
5. Performance Reviews
6. Coaching and Employee Development’
7. Letting People Go
8. Communication and Change Management
